Eating Disorders and Diabetes
Diabetes significantly increases the risk of disordered eating, with alarming statistics showing that young women with type one diabetes are particularly vulnerable. The intense focus on food management and dietary restrictions often leads to obsessive behaviors, yet this issue remains largely unaddressed in both conventional and alternative healthcare systems.
